Abstract
The ray trace equations for a dielectric lens reflector with a tilted linear front surface are derived, and the reflecting profile obtained. A thin lens results when the angle of tilt is such that the lens reflector has zero thickness at the apex. It is found that, for fixed radius and maximum subtended angle at the focus, the reflecting profile is approximately constant with angle of tilt and can, to the same approximation, be constructed from circular arcs.
